OpenFlow Based Dynamic Flow Scheduling with Multipath for Data Center Networks

被引:0
作者
Yu, Haisheng [1 ]
Qi, Heng [1 ]
Li, Keqiu [1 ]
Zhang, Jianhui [1 ]
Xiao, Peng [2 ]
Wang, Xun [1 ]
机构
[1] Dalian Univ Technol, Sch Comp Sci & Technol, Dalian, Peoples R China
[2] Dalian Polytech Univ, Sch Informat Sci & Engn, Dalian, Peoples R China
来源
COMPUTER SYSTEMS SCIENCE AND ENGINEERING | 2018年 / 33卷 / 04期
关键词
Data Center; Software-defined Networking; ECMP; DLB; FC-DLB;
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
The routing mechanism in Data Center networks can affect network performance and latency significantly. Hash-based method, such as ECMP (Equal-Cost Multi-Path), has been widely used in Data Center networks to fulfill the requirement of load balance. However, ECMP statically maps one flow to a path by a hash method, which results in some paths overloaded while others remain underutilized. Some dynamic flow scheduling schemes choose the most underutilized link as the next hop to better utilize the network bandwidth, while these schemes lacks of utilizing the global state of the network. To achieve high bandwidth utilization and low latency, we present a dynamic flow scheduling mechanism based on OpenFlow protocol which enables monitoring the global network information by a centralized controller. Depending on the network statistics obtained by the OpenFlow controller, the routing algorithm chooses the best path for the flow. Because there are two kinds of flows in a Data Center, short-lived flows and long-lived flows, we proposed two different algorithms for them. The implementation uses pox as OpenFlow controller and mininet as the network emulator. The evaluation results demonstrate that our dynamic flow scheduling algorithm is effective and can achieve high link utilization
引用
收藏
页码:251 / 258
页数:8
相关论文
共 50 条
  • [1] Multipath protection for data center services in OpenFlow-based software defined elastic optical networks
    Yang, Hui
    Cheng, Lei
    Yuan, Jian
    Zhang, Jie
    Zhao, Yongli
    Lee, Young
    OPTICAL FIBER TECHNOLOGY, 2015, 23 : 108 - 115
  • [2] Ashman: A Bandwidth Fragmentation-Based Dynamic Flow Scheduling for Data Center Networks
    Song, Tao
    Liu, Yuchen
    Wang, Yiding
    Ma, Ruhui
    Liang, Alei
    Qi, Zhengwei
    Guan, Haibing
    COMPUTER JOURNAL, 2017, 60 (10) : 1498 - 1509
  • [3] Multipath Routing in SDN-based Data Center Networks
    Lei, Yi-Chih
    Wang, Kuochen
    Hsu, Yi-Huai
    2015 EUROPEAN CONFERENCE ON NETWORKS AND COMMUNICATIONS (EUCNC), 2015, : 365 - 369
  • [4] Dynamic Virtual Network Allocation for OpenFlow Based Cloud Resident Data Center
    Tri Trinh
    Esaki, Hiroshi
    Aswakul, Chaodit
    IEICE TRANSACTIONS ON COMMUNICATIONS, 2013, E96B (01) : 56 - 64
  • [5] Data Center Optical Networks (DCON) with OpenFlow based Software Defined Networking (SDN)
    Zhao, Yongli
    Zhang, Jie
    Yang, Hui
    Yu, Xiaosong
    2013 8TH INTERNATIONAL ICST CONFERENCE ON COMMUNICATIONS AND NETWORKING IN CHINA (CHINACOM), 2013, : 771 - 775
  • [6] An OpenFlow Based Dynamic Traffic Scheduling Strategy for Load Balancing
    Guo Xiao
    Wu Wenjun
    Zhao Jiaming
    Fang Chao
    Zhang Yanhua
    PROCEEDINGS OF 2017 3RD IEEE INTERNATIONAL CONFERENCE ON COMPUTER AND COMMUNICATIONS (ICCC), 2017, : 531 - 535
  • [7] Approximate Dynamic Programming Based Data Center Resource Dynamic Scheduling for Energy Optimization
    Li, Xue
    Nie, Lanshun
    Chen, Shuo
    2014 IEEE INTERNATIONAL CONFERENCE (ITHINGS) - 2014 IEEE INTERNATIONAL CONFERENCE ON GREEN COMPUTING AND COMMUNICATIONS (GREENCOM) - 2014 IEEE INTERNATIONAL CONFERENCE ON CYBER-PHYSICAL-SOCIAL COMPUTING (CPS), 2014, : 494 - 501
  • [8] On the Usability of OpenFlow in Data Center Environments
    Pries, Rastin
    Jarschel, Michael
    Goll, Sebastian
    2012 IEEE INTERNATIONAL CONFERENCE ON COMMUNICATIONS (ICC), 2012,
  • [9] Two-Phase Load Balancing for Data Center Networks using OpenFlow
    Maksic, Natasa
    2017 25TH TELECOMMUNICATION FORUM (TELFOR), 2017, : 107 - 110
  • [10] Scheduling with Machine-Learning-Based Flow Detection for Packet-Switched Optical Data Center Networks
    Wang, Lin
    Wang, Xinbo
    Tornatore, Massimo
    Kim, Kwang Joon
    Kim, Sun Me
    Kim, Dae-Ub
    Han, Kyeong-Eun
    Mukherjee, Biswanath
    JOURNAL OF OPTICAL COMMUNICATIONS AND NETWORKING, 2018, 10 (04) : 365 - 375